eOne Strengthens Peppa Pig Presence in French Market
Entertainment One (eOne) continues to solidify the presence of the beloved Peppa Pig brand in France with an ambitious expansion strategy that targets multiple facets of the market. The initiative includes new licensing deals, increased merchandising, and innovative partnerships designed to captivate French consumers of all ages. This effort aims not only to sustain Peppa Pig’s popularity among toddlers but also to reach a broader demographic through refreshed product lines and local adaptations.
Key elements of the strategy include:
- Exclusive collaborations with French toy manufacturers and apparel companies
- Expansion of digital content including local-language apps and streaming options
- Increased presence in retail outlets with special promotions and in-store events
- Launch of educational materials designed for early childhood learning aligned with French curricula
| Category | New Initiatives | Launch Period |
|---|---|---|
| Merchandising | Eco-friendly toys and apparel | Q3 2024 |
| Digital Content | Interactive story apps in French | Q4 2024 |
| Educational | Workbooks and classroom tools | 2025 Academic Year |
